Become a Pharmacy Technician with Pueblo Community College

Are you interested in becoming a certified pharmacy technician? Pueblo Community College (PCC) offers an accredited pharmacy technician program that can provide you with the skills needed to become a certified pharmacy technician.

Program Accreditation

The PCC pharmacy technician program is accredited by the American Society of Health-System Pharmacists (ASHP). This accreditation ensures that the program meets national standards of pharmacy technician education.

On Campus or Online?

The PCC pharmacy technician program is offered exclusively on campus.

Prerequisites

In order to enroll in the PCC pharmacy technician program, students must meet the following prerequisites:

  • High school diploma or GED
  • Pass a background check
  • Complete a physical exam
  • Submit proof of vaccinations

How to Apply

Students interested in enrolling in the PCC pharmacy technician program must first complete an online application form. Once the application is processed, students must then attend an orientation session.

How Long Does the Program Take?

The PCC pharmacy technician program typically takes one year to complete.

Average Salary for Certified Pharmacy Technicians in Colorado

According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the average salary for a certified pharmacy technician in Colorado is $32,550 a year. Salary estimates for the Pueblo, CO area are slightly higher at $33,500 a year.
